How Tall Is the Empire State Building? A Complete Guide
The Empire State Building stands at an impressive 1,454 feet (443.2 meters) from its base to the tip of its antenna, making it one of the most iconic skyscrapers in the world. Without the antenna, the height is 1,250 feet (381 meters). Since its completion in 1931, this architectural marvel has been a symbol of New York City and a benchmark in skyscraper design. More than just its towering presence, the building offers a rich history, breathtaking views, and an enduring place in both American culture and global architecture.
1. Background and History of the Empire State Building
Construction of the Empire State Building began in March 1930 and was completed in just 13 months, opening officially on May 1, 1931. At that time, it was the tallest building in the world, surpassing the Chrysler Building. Designed by the architectural firm Shreve, Lamb & Harmon, it became a symbol of ambition during the Great Depression.
The building’s name comes from New York State’s nickname, “The Empire State.” Over the decades, it has appeared in countless movies, including King Kong and Sleepless in Seattle, cementing its place in popular culture.
2. Height Details and Key Measurements
| Measurement | Feet | Meters |
|---|---|---|
| Roof Height | 1,250 ft | 381 m |
| Total Height (including antenna) | 1,454 ft | 443.2 m |
| Observation Deck Heights | 86th Floor – 1,050 ft | 320 m |
| Spire Height Alone | 204 ft | 62.2 m |
These measurements make it taller than the Eiffel Tower and a dominant feature in the Manhattan skyline.
3. Comparison with Other Skyscrapers
When it opened, the Empire State Building was the tallest in the world. Today, it ranks lower due to modern skyscrapers like:
-
Burj Khalifa, Dubai – 2,717 ft (828 m)
-
Shanghai Tower, China – 2,073 ft (632 m)
-
One World Trade Center, NYC – 1,776 ft (541 m)
However, its art deco design and historical importance give it a unique prestige that newer towers often lack.

6. Safety, Engineering, and Reliability Aspects
The building is constructed with a steel frame and limestone facade, designed to withstand high winds. Its antenna has been updated for broadcasting technology, and strict fire and safety codes ensure visitor protection.
In 2010, sustainability upgrades earned it LEED Gold Certification, proving that even historic landmarks can be environmentally forward-thinking.

Legally Separated vs Divorced: The Real Truth Most Couples Never Learn
Ending a marriage is never simple. Emotions run high, finances matter, and long-term consequences follow every choice. Many people rush toward divorce without realizing there is another legal option that may better fit their situation. Understanding Legally Separated vs Divorced can help you make a decision that protects your future instead of creating regret.
This guide explains both paths clearly, without legal jargon. You will learn how each option works, who it is best for, and how it affects money, children, and personal freedom. The goal is not to push you in one direction but to help you choose wisely.
What Does Legal Separation Really Mean?
Legal separation is a formal court-recognized arrangement where a married couple lives apart but remains legally married. The court approves agreements related to finances, property, child custody, and support.
Even though the marriage is still intact, daily life often looks similar to divorce. You may live separately, manage your own expenses, and follow court-ordered responsibilities. The key difference is marital status.
Legal separation is often chosen when:
- Divorce conflicts with religious or cultural beliefs
- Health insurance coverage depends on marital status
- Couples want time apart without permanently ending the marriage
- Financial or tax reasons make divorce risky in the short term
This option allows structure without finality.

What Divorce Means in Practical Terms
Divorce is the legal termination of a marriage. Once finalized, both parties are legally single and free to remarry. Courts divide assets, decide custody, and may assign spousal or child support.
Divorce creates closure. It also removes legal ties related to inheritance, decision-making, and financial responsibility unless otherwise stated by court orders.
Divorce is often chosen when:
- Reconciliation is no longer desired
- One or both spouses want to remarry
- Financial independence is a priority
- Emotional closure is necessary for healing
Understanding Legally Separated vs Divorced starts with recognizing how permanent divorce truly is.
Key Legal and Financial Differences Explained Simply
Although they may seem similar on the surface, legal separation and divorce affect life in very different ways.
Marital Status
Legal separation keeps you married. Divorce does not.
Property and Debt
Both options can divide assets and debts through court orders. However, divorce usually creates a final and irreversible split.
Health Insurance
Many insurance plans allow coverage during legal separation but not after divorce.
Taxes
Legally separated couples may still file jointly in some cases. Divorced couples cannot.
Inheritance Rights
Legal spouses often retain inheritance rights unless waived. Divorce removes these rights entirely.

Comparison Chart: Legal Separation vs Divorce
| Feature | Legal Separation | Divorce |
|---|---|---|
| Marital Status | Still married | Marriage ended |
| Ability to Remarry | Not allowed | Allowed |
| Court Orders | Yes | Yes |
| Asset Division | Temporary or permanent | Permanent |
| Health Insurance | Often retained | Usually lost |
| Emotional Finality | Moderate | High |
| Religious Acceptance | Often acceptable | Sometimes restricted |
| Reversibility | Can reconcile easily | Requires remarriage |
This chart helps clarify Legally Separated vs Divorced in a practical, side-by-side format.

What Is a Lawyer Injury Claim?
A lawyer injury claim is a legal action taken after someone is harmed because of another party’s negligence. These claims aim to recover financial compensation for physical injuries, emotional suffering, and economic losses.
Common situations include:
- Vehicle accidents
- Workplace injuries
- Slip and fall incidents
- Medical errors
- Unsafe property conditions
The law allows injured individuals to seek compensation when responsibility can be proven.

How Compensation Is Calculated
Compensation usually includes:
Economic Damages
- Medical bills
- Lost wages
- Future care costs
Non-Economic Damages
- Pain and suffering
- Emotional distress
- Reduced quality of life
Future Losses
- Long-term disability
- Ongoing treatment needs
Accurate calculation requires experience and proper documentation.
